SHOPIAN — An encounter broke out between militants and security forces in Pandoshan area of Zainapora hamlet in south Kashmir’s Shopian district on Monday, officials said.

A top police officer told news agency Kashmir Dot Com (KDC) that a joint team of Police, Army and CRPF launched a cordon and search operation on specific information about the presence of militants in the area.

He said that as the joint team of forces approached the suspected spot, militants fired upon them which was retaliated, triggering an encounter.

As per the sources, one to two militants are believed to be hiding in the area.
